Ok, the ball itself weighs 604 grams, and the wax from one cheese wheel weighs approximately 3.5 grams (two of them were 7 grams total according to my scale, but it's a kitchen scale so it doesn't give tenths of a gram)

My total current count for waxes on the ball is 166, 604 ÷ 166 = 3.6g, so that tracks pretty close.

I split the wax on each cheese into four pieces - after you pull the paper strip there's also a seam running around the outer rim of the cheese, it tears apart easily there. Then just work each piece in where I think it looks off-round. To bring it all together I roll it on a piece of paper on my desk (the paper is just to make cleanup easier)
